People and Culture: The Human Side of CXO Digital Transformation Leadership Models
Technology is powerful, but it’s people who make it happen. CXO digital transformation leadership models highlight the need for a culture that embraces change. This includes fostering skills development, encouraging collaboration, and addressing resistance to new technologies.
Picture a symphony orchestra—each musician (or employee) must play in harmony for the performance to shine. Leaders using CXO digital transformation leadership models often implement training programs and change management techniques, like those from the Prosci ADKAR model, to ensure buy-in. Step-by-Step Guide to Applying CXO Digital Transformation Leadership Models
- Assess Your Current State: Begin by auditing your organization’s digital maturity. Use tools from CXO digital transformation leadership models like Gartner’s Pace-Layered Application Strategy to categorize tech assets.
- Set Measurable Goals: Define KPIs that align with your vision. For example, aim for a 20% improvement in operational efficiency within a year, drawing from CXO digital transformation leadership models that emphasize outcomes over outputs.
- Build a Cross-Functional Team: Assemble a team that includes IT, marketing, and frontline staff. CXO digital transformation leadership models stress collaboration to avoid silos, much like a sports team working together for a win.
- Execute and Iterate: Roll out pilots and gather feedback. Leaders often use agile methodologies within CXO digital transformation leadership models to adapt quickly, reducing risks and enhancing results.
- Measure and Optimize: Track progress with dashboards and analytics. If something’s not working, tweak it—CXO digital transformation leadership models are all about continuous improvement.
